It started with some crappy running, but I'm used to that by now. But
at some point in the weekend, my (now this is an amateur guess based on
what used to happen in my BMWs) shift linkage came loose.
Symptoms: it has the usual resistance when I push it side to side in
neutral, but up and down has absolutely none. It even stays where I
push it. It is also harder to get into gear (esp. reverse). Any BTDTs
would be appreciated, and if anybody told me (truthfully) that it could
be fixed with the Blau short shift kit, I would be stoked.
